// Copyright (c) Microsoft Corporation
// The Microsoft Corporation licenses this file to you under the MIT license.
// See the LICENSE file in the project root for more information.
using System;
using System.Globalization;
using NUnit.Framework;
namespace Microsoft.Plugin.Calculator.UnitTests
{
[TestFixture]
public class ExtendedCalculatorParserTests
{
[TestCase(null)]
[TestCase("")]
[TestCase(" ")]
public void InputValid_ThrowError_WhenCalledNullOrEmpty(string input)
{
// Act
Assert.Catch<ArgumentNullException>(() => CalculateHelper.InputValid(input));
}
[TestCase(null)]
[TestCase("")]
[TestCase(" ")]
public void Interpret_ThrowError_WhenCalledNullOrEmpty(string input)
{
// Arrange
var engine = new CalculateEngine();
// Act
Assert.Catch<ArgumentNullException>(() => engine.Interpret(input));
}
[TestCase("42")]
[TestCase("test")]
public void Interpret_NoResult_WhenCalled(string input)
{
// Arrange
var engine = new CalculateEngine();
// Act
var result = engine.Interpret(input);
// Assert
Assert.AreEqual(default(CalculateResult), result);
}
[TestCase("2 * 2", 4D)]
[TestCase("-2 ^ 2", 4D)]
[TestCase("-(2 ^ 2)", -4D)]
[TestCase("2 * pi", 6.28318530717959D)]
[TestCase("round(2 * pi)", 6D)]
[TestCase("1 == 2", default(double))]
[TestCase("pi * ( sin ( cos ( 2)))", -1.26995475603563D)]
[TestCase("5.6/2", 2.8D)]
[TestCase("123 * 4.56", 560.88D)]
[TestCase("1 - 9.0 / 10", 0.1D)]
[TestCase("0.5 * ((2*-395.2)+198.2)", -296.1D)]
[TestCase("2+2.11", 4.11D)]
public void Interpret_NoErrors_WhenCalled(string input, decimal expectedResult)
{
// Arrange
var engine = new CalculateEngine();
// Act
var result = engine.Interpret(input, CultureInfo.InvariantCulture);
// Assert
Assert.IsNotNull(result);
Assert.AreEqual(expectedResult, result.Result);
}
[TestCase("0.100000000000000000000", 0.00776627963145224D)] // BUG: Because data structure
[TestCase("0.200000000000000000000000", 0.000000400752841041379D)] // BUG: Because data structure
[TestCase("123 456", 56088D)] // BUG: Framework accepts ' ' as multiplication
public void Interpret_QuirkOutput_WhenCalled(string input, decimal expectedResult)
{
// Arrange
var engine = new CalculateEngine();
// Act
var result = engine.Interpret(input, CultureInfo.InvariantCulture);
// Assert
Assert.IsNotNull(result);
Assert.AreEqual(expectedResult, result.Result);
}
[TestCase("4.5/3", 1.5D, "nl-NL")]
[TestCase("4.5/3", 1.5D, "en-EN")]
[TestCase("4.5/3", 1.5D, "de-DE")]
public void Interpret_DifferentCulture_WhenCalled(string input, decimal expectedResult, string cultureName)
{
// Arrange
var cultureInfo = CultureInfo.GetCultureInfo(cultureName);
var engine = new CalculateEngine();
// Act
var result = engine.Interpret(input, cultureInfo);
// Assert
Assert.IsNotNull(result);
Assert.AreEqual(expectedResult, result.Result);
}
[TestCase("ceil(2 * (pi ^ 2))", true)]
[TestCase("((1 * 2)", false)]
[TestCase("(1 * 2)))", false)]
[TestCase("abcde", false)]
[TestCase("plot( 2 * 3)", true)]
public void InputValid_TestValid_WhenCalled(string input, bool valid)
{
// Arrange
// Act
var result = CalculateHelper.InputValid(input);
// Assert
Assert.AreEqual(valid, result);
}
}
}
